The is a highly specialized, ultra-compact hardware dongle designed to bridge modern USB computing ports with legacy and industrial infrared wireless technologies. By transforming a standard USB-A port into a fully functional Infrared Data Association (IrDA) transceiver, this device allows users to communicate with specialized, legacy, or closed-ecosystem hardware. It supports Fast Infrared ( FIR ) transmission speeds up to 4 Mbps and utilizes a USB 2.0 interface , delivering low-latency, point-and-shoot data synchronization in a portable form factor. 🛠 Core Technical Specifications

Very bright, direct sunlight or intense halogen lighting can flood the infrared sensor and cause interference. Dimming the overhead lights in an industrial or clinical setting often yields a more stable connection.

Many industrial smart meters, such as electricity, water, and gas counters, utilize localized optical infrared communication windows (like the IEC62056 standard) to extract logged metrics. Field technicians leverage the adapter to plug into field laptops and swiftly capture usage data securely without risking radio frequency cross-contamination. 2.
